Выполнение пакетов служб SQL Server Integration Services (SSIS), развернутых в Azure
Область применения: среда выполнения интеграции SSIS SQL Server в Фабрика данных Azure
Для выполнения пакетов служб SSIS, развернутых в каталоге SSISDB на сервере базы данных SQL Azure, можно выбрать один из методов, описанных в этой статье. Пакет можно выполнять напрямую или в составе конвейера фабрики данных Azure. Общие сведения о службах SSIS в Azure см. в статье Развертывание и выполнение пакетов служб SSIS в Azure.
Выполнение пакета напрямую
Выполнение пакета в составе конвейера фабрики данных Azure
Примечание.
Выполнение пакета с помощью dtexec.exe
не проверялось с пакетами, развернутыми в Azure.
Запуск пакета с помощью SSMS
В среде SQL Server Management Studio (SSMS) щелкните правой кнопкой мыши пакет, развернутый в базе данных каталога служб SSIS (SSISDB), и выберите Выполнить, чтобы открыть диалоговое окно Выполнение пакета. Дополнительные сведения см. в разделе Выполнение пакета служб SSIS с помощью SQL Server Management Studio (SSMS).
Запуск пакета с хранимыми процедурами
Пакет можно выполнить в любой среде, из которой можно подключиться к базе данных SQL Azure и запустить код Transact-SQL. Для этого вызовите следующие хранимые процедуры.
[catalog].[create_execution]. Дополнительные сведения см. в статье catalog.deploy_packages.
[catalog].[set_execution_parameter_value]. Дополнительные сведения см. в статье catalog.set_execution_parameter_value.
[catalog].[start_execution]. Дополнительные сведения см. в статье catalog.start_execution.
Дополнительные сведения см. в следующих примерах:
Запуск пакета с помощью скрипта или кода
Пакет можно выполнить в любой среде разработки, из которой можно вызвать управляемый API. Для этого вызовите метод Execute
для объекта Package
в пространстве имен Microsoft.SQLServer.Management.IntegrationServices
.
Дополнительные сведения см. в следующих примерах:
Запуск пакета с действием "Выполнение пакета служб SSIS"
Дополнительные сведения см. в статье Выполнение пакета служб SSIS с помощью действия "Выполнение пакета служб SSIS" в фабрике данных Azure.
Запуск пакета с действием хранимой процедуры
Дополнительные сведения см. в статье Выполнение пакета служб SSIS с помощью действия хранимой процедуры в фабрике данных Azure.
Следующие шаги
Узнайте о способах планирования выполнения пакетов служб SSIS, развернутых в Azure. Дополнительные сведения см. в разделе Планирование выполнения пакетов служб SSIS в Azure.